Engineering with KISS at University in Mexico

KISS is Everywhere‬! SO COOL!!

Mexican engineering students (robotics) from Tec de Monterrey in Campus Estado de M�xico, attending to the final project session. They had to build a LED matrix and show a KISS logo "dancing" at the rhythm of a KISS song (each team selected a different song). Everyone had to select a ‪KISS‬ character and they had to wear that makeup for this session (BTW, I'm the one at the top).

Preaching the KISS Gospel and recruiting new members for the ‪KISS Army‬!

KISS frontman to serve up craft beer, national anthem at Spurs game

By Hector Saldana / San Antonio Express

A bona fide rock god will be singing �The Star-Spangled Banner� and touting craft suds Friday at the AT&T Center.

Paul Stanley, the Starchild of the legendary rock act Kiss, will be at center court before the Spurs play the Los Angeles Lakers. He�ll be in town for the grand opening of Rock & Brews, the new classic rock-themed restaurant and craft beer pub at the renovated arena. Stanley and bandmate Gene Simmons are among the cofounders of the venture launched in 2012.

This is the first Rock & Brews at a sports arena, and the Spurs want that fact shouted out loud.

Rick Pych, Spurs Sports & Entertainment president of business operations, said the organization is honored to have the Rock and Roll Hall of Famer in the house.

�Gene Simmons and Paul Stanley have utilized the same passion and enthusiasm that made Kiss a rock legend to create a fantastic restaurant experience,� Pych said.

Bill Summersett, a San Antonio native and Kiss memorabilia collector who for decades was a diehard member of the Kiss Army, said the family restaurant will be a hit.

�I�m sure it�s gonna draw a ton of people,� said Summersett, who has been to more than 30 Kiss concerts. He has caught guitars Stanley broke and threw off stage, and he has owned items such as a Kiss pinball machine, Kiss condoms and Kiss comic books printed with red ink that included the group members� blood.

�Paul Stanley and Gene Simmons are marketing geniuses. There�s nothing they haven�t made,� Summersett said.

Rock & Brews combines Stanley�s love of cooking, local produce and classic rock. Away from Kiss, he plays with the soul and R&B revue Soul Station.

Stanley recently talked by phone about craft beer, culinary possibilities and being grateful for rock �n� roll.

Did you ever imagine the rise of craft beer culture?

Beer has become the new wine. Beer is crafted, at this point, by people who understand notes and where it hits you on the palate. The care that�s put into it has been a long time coming. It�s very interesting to see beer go beyond something that you guzzle at a sports event or that you drink for a buzz.

Which is trendier, rock �n� roll or food?

One doesn�t rule the other. Rock �n� roll is essential. The foundation of Rock & Brews certainly is a love of classic rock. But then that foundation is used to build something very unique, almost a lifestyle, where people can enjoy great beer, great food, and I don�t mean franchise slop. (It�s) a food experience where if you want to bring your children out for the day, you don�t have to eat cardboard pizza served by somebody dressed as a rat.

What�s your favorite Rock & Brews craft beer?

I love a rich, dark lager. But we have samplers where there are multiple glasses and it�s great to sample in the same way you might sample different wines.

How about the food?

I think the fish tacos are awesome. The burgers are off the charts. We have pretzels. Everybody is used to soft pretzels. But our pretzel dough comes in from Germany. We have a beer cheese that�s awesome to dip in.

No orange cheese nachos?

There�s nothing wrong with that. We�ve all sat at games and had that cheese food product. God only knows what it is. Why not enjoy something that�s really, really good? Once you elevate your taste buds a bit there�s no going back.

Why are you so active in the promotion?

I don�t believe in putting my name on anything I don�t believe in.

What about the national anthem?

I did it at Dodger games. I starred in �Phantom of the Opera.� So I consider myself a singer that sings rock as opposed to a rock singer. �The Star-Spangled Banner� is a real interesting one in that people tend to obliterate it when they do it and turn it into a showcase for vocal gymnastics instead of singing it as it was written. If you�re looking for showboating, you�re not going to hear it. The anthem should be sung with respect.

Paul Stanley talks about Rock & Brews expansion into arenas

By W. Scott Bailey / L.A. BIZ

San Antonio is making some new rock �n� roll history. The Alamo City will serve as a testing ground of sorts for a relatively young restaurant company whose partners include Paul Stanley and Gene Simmons of the iconic rock band KISS.

Rock & Brews, which is based in Manhattan Beach, will make its official debut in San Antonio at the AT&T Center on Dec. 11. During an exclusive interview with Stanley, the KISS front man said the Alamo City restaurant will represent Rock & Brew�s initial entry into the sports stadium scene.

�This is our first arena installation. This is the one that will lead the way,� Stanley said about the AT&T Center venue, which will feature a rock �n� roll theme, American comfort food and a wide selection of craft beers.

Stanley said Rock & Brews partners were looking for an opportunity to expand the restaurant and bar concept hatched roughly five years ago into the sports stadium setting.

�Moving into arenas now just seems like the next logical step,� Stanley told me. �We�ve done quite a bit of research into arenas. San Antonio and AT&T Center came up at the forefront.�

It helps that KISS has a long-standing connection to San Antonio, having performed in the Alamo City numerous times over its more than 40-year run.

�Our history with San Antonio goes back literally decades,� Stanley said. �It�s been terrific. To watch it thrive and grow has been very satisfying for me. So we couldn�t pick a better place. We came up with a deal that worked out for everyone, and we are proud of the installation.�

Rock & Brews will work to integrate local flavors and products at its San Antonio venue.�We want to be good stewards,� Stanley said.

If all goes as expected, Rock & Brews could expand its presence in a city with a rich rock history, as well as a growing reputation in the culinary and craft beer industries.

�Does San Antonio deserve another one? I would say so,� Stanley said, when asked if Rock & Brews would consider developing a more traditional, free-standing restaurant in the Alamo City to complement the AT&T Center venue. �The people in San Antonio will ultimately decide.�

SKECHERS� PRESIDENT MICHAEL GREENBERG APPOINTED TO BOARD OF DIRECTORS ROCK & BREWS RESTAURANT BRAND

KISS Front Men Tap Footwear Giant As They Continue Thoughtful Expansion of Their Popular Restaurant Brand

Rock icons Gene Simmons and Paul Stanley of KISS, announced today that they have appointed Michael Greenberg, president of SKECHERS USA, Inc., to the board of directors of their rapidly expanding restaurant company, Rock & Brews.  

Rock & Brews was co-founded by Simmons and Stanley along with restauranteur Michael Zislis and concert industry veterans Dave and Dell Furano and currently has 12 family-friendly restaurants in the United States and Mexico with three additional locations set to open by January 2016. Having recently completed a rollup forming Rock & Brews Holdings, LLC, the company, founded in 2012, expects to surpass $70 million in revenues in 2016 with plans for 30 percent growth annually for the foreseeable future.

�Greenberg has the entrepreneurial spirit, business savvy, enthusiasm and social consciousness to help Rock & Brews expand strategically and intelligently,� said Simmons and Stanley in a joint statement.  �He is a visionary and we are proud to have the opportunity to tap his genius.�

Greenberg is a 30-year veteran and a distinguished visionary in the footwear industry.  He co-founded SKECHERS with his father Robert Greenberg in 1992, and has served as president since its inception.  He previously held senior positions with LA Gear.  

In just 23 years with SKECHERS, Greenberg has taken an idea and turned it into an international success story.  The company, recognized worldwide for both its high performance athletic shoes and trendy lifestyle footwear, experienced meteoric growth and currently sells product in more than 120 countries with annual sales in excess of $2.3 billion.  As a result of numerous license agreements, SKECHERS also offers branded apparel, bags, watches, eyewear and additional merchandise.  

 �From day one, SKECHERS focused on product development, compelling marketing and an aggressive growth strategy and we found the winning combination that propelled our brand and filled a niche in the industry that appealed to a broad consumer audience,� said Greenberg. �Rock & Brews is a unique brand that appeals to a multi-generational audience and I am excited to be a part of their board of directors and a part of their growth.�

It is not only Greenberg�s success with SKECHERS that appealed to Rock & Brews. A consummate entrepreneur with a magic touch, he has also been instrumental in the successful expansion of a notable Southern California-based pizza company, and was one of the co-founders of the luxury boutique hotel brand Shade Hotels.  The flagship Shade Hotel in Manhattan Beach, Calif., has been named the #6 reason to visit Los Angeles by Conde Nast Traveler, one of the top 25 �trendiest hotels� by Trip Advisor, and one of the top 10 boutique hotels in Southern California in USA Today.

Rock & Brews has captured a significant amount of restaurant industry attention and, working with multi-unit franchise partners, the brand is expanding with three distinct concepts into communities, airports and arenas.  Only two years after the first restaurant opened, Nation�s Restaurant News named Rock & Brews as one of the 10 cutting edge restaurant concepts set to redefine foodservice on its 2014 list of �Breakout Brands� and, most recently, the magazine included the brand among the �Next 20� restaurant chains poised to join the Top 200 in the industry.   Restaurant Business Magazine also recognized Rock & Brews as one of the �Future 50� fastest-growing small chains in America in its June 2015 issue.
